# DAS Trader Python API Client

<div align="center">

[![License: MIT](https://img.shields.io/badge/License-MIT-yellow.svg)](https://opensource.org/licenses/MIT)
[![Python 3.8+](https://img.shields.io/badge/python-3.8+-blue.svg)](https://www.python.org/downloads/)

[English](README.md) | [Español](README.es.md)

</div>

Complete Python client for the DAS Trader Pro CMD API that enables automated trading, real-time order management, position tracking, and market data streaming.

## 🚀 Key Features

### Core Trading Capabilities
- **Complete Trading**: Send, modify, and cancel orders (Market, Limit, Stop, Peg, etc.)
- **Real-Time Market Data**: Level 1, Level 2, and Time & Sales streaming
- **Position Management**: Automatic position tracking and real-time P&L
- **Historical Data**: Access to daily and minute charts
- **Specific Order Queries**: Get pending orders and executed orders separately

### Enhanced Features
- **Production-Grade Logging**: Structured logging with rotation and masking
- **Connection Resilience**: Circuit breaker pattern with exponential backoff
- **Configuration Management**: Environment variables and JSON config support
- **Enhanced Error Handling**: Categorized exceptions with recovery guidance
- **Multi-Format Parsing**: Handles various DAS response formats
- **Automatic Reconnection**: Robust connection handling with auto-reconnect
- **Native Asyncio**: High performance with concurrent operations
- **Type Safety**: Fully typed for better IDE support

## 🎯 Basic Usage

```python
import asyncio
from das_trader import DASTraderClient, OrderSide, OrderType, MarketDataLevel

async def main():
    # Create client
    client = DASTraderClient(host="localhost", port=9910)
    
    try:
        # Connect to DAS Trader
        await client.connect("your_username", "your_password", "your_account")
        
        # Get buying power
        bp = await client.get_buying_power()
        print(f"Buying Power: ${bp['buying_power']:,.2f}")
        
        # Subscribe to market data
        await client.subscribe_quote("AAPL", MarketDataLevel.LEVEL1)
        
        # Get quote
        quote = await client.get_quote("AAPL")
        print(f"AAPL: Bid ${quote.bid} | Ask ${quote.ask} | Last ${quote.last}")
        
        # Send order
        order_id = await client.send_order(
            symbol="AAPL",
            side=OrderSide.BUY,
            quantity=100,
            order_type=OrderType.LIMIT,
            price=150.00
        )
        print(f"Order sent: {order_id}")
        
        # Check positions
        positions = client.get_positions()
        for pos in positions:
            if not pos.is_flat():
                print(f"{pos.symbol}: {pos.quantity} shares, "
                      f"P&L: ${pos.unrealized_pnl:.2f}")
        
    finally:
        await client.disconnect()

if __name__ == "__main__":
    asyncio.run(main())
```

## 📊 Supported Order Types

```python
# Market Order
await client.send_order("AAPL", OrderSide.BUY, 100, OrderType.MARKET)

# Limit Order
await client.send_order("AAPL", OrderSide.BUY, 100, OrderType.LIMIT, price=150.00)

# Stop Loss
await client.send_order("AAPL", OrderSide.SELL, 100, OrderType.STOP, stop_price=145.00)

# Stop Limit
await client.send_order("AAPL", OrderSide.SELL, 100, OrderType.STOP_LIMIT,
                       price=148.00, stop_price=145.00)

# Trailing Stop
await client.send_order("AAPL", OrderSide.SELL, 100, OrderType.TRAILING_STOP,
                       trail_amount=2.00)
```

## 📈 Callbacks and Events

```python
# Order callbacks
def on_order_filled(order):
    print(f"Order filled: {order.symbol}")

def on_order_rejected(order):
    print(f"Order rejected: {order.symbol}")

client.orders.register_callback("order_filled", on_order_filled)
client.orders.register_callback("order_rejected", on_order_rejected)

# Position callbacks
def on_position_update(position):
    print(f"Position updated: {position.symbol} P&L: ${position.unrealized_pnl:.2f}")

client.positions.register_callback("position_updated", on_position_update)

# Market data callbacks
def on_quote_update(quote):
    print(f"{quote.symbol}: ${quote.last}")

client.market_data.register_callback("quote_update", on_quote_update)
```

## 📚 API Documentation

### Main Classes

- **`DASTraderClient`**: Main client for interacting with DAS Trader
- **`OrderManager`**: Order management and status tracking
- **`PositionManager`**: Position tracking and P&L
- **`MarketDataManager`**: Market data streaming and caching
- **`ConnectionManager`**: TCP connection handling and reconnection
- **`NotificationManager`**: Multi-platform notification system

### Main Enums

- **`OrderType`**: MARKET, LIMIT, STOP, STOP_LIMIT, PEG, TRAILING_STOP
- **`OrderSide`**: BUY, SELL, SHORT, COVER
- **`OrderStatus`**: PENDING, NEW, PARTIALLY_FILLED, FILLED, CANCELLED, REJECTED
- **`TimeInForce`**: DAY, GTC, IOC, FOK, MOO, MOC
- **`MarketDataLevel`**: LEVEL1, LEVEL2, TIME_SALES
